Overview
The Tooling Technician plays a critical role in ensuring the quality, accuracy, and readiness of molds, dies, and tooling components prior to production release. This position partners closely with Tooling, Engineering, Quality, and external vendors to perform precision inspections, validate tooling conformance, and support continuous improvement initiatives that drive manufacturing excellence.
Responsibilities
- Perform incoming inspection, validation, and acceptance of new, repaired, and modified molds, dies, and tooling components from internal and external suppliers
- Assign tooling serial numbers and maintain tooling identification, traceability, and inventory records
- Verify tooling dimensional accuracy, surface finish quality, and completeness against engineering drawings, CAD models, specifications, and acceptance criteria
- Identify and document tooling non-conformances, including dimensional discrepancies, surface defects, assembly concerns, and incomplete features
- Collaborate with Tooling, Engineering, and vendor partners to resolve quality issues and track corrective actions to closure
- Utilize precision metrology equipment including CMMs, interferometers, height gauges, micrometers, calipers, bore gauges, and optical comparators to perform detailed inspections
- Develop and execute inspection plans based on tolerances, GD&T requirements, and critical-to-quality characteristics
- Conduct dimensional inspections of core and cavity geometry, alignment features, shut-offs, cooling channels, and other critical tooling components
- Analyze and record measurement data to verify compliance with engineering specifications and quality standards
- Perform detailed visual inspections of mold components including cores, cavities, slides, lifters, ejector systems, and hot runner interfaces
- Evaluate surface finishes, polish quality, venting features, edge conditions, assembly fit, and overall tooling functionality
- Generate comprehensive inspection reports detailing dimensional results, visual findings, acceptance status, and non-conformance documentation
- Maintain accurate records of tooling inspections, vendor quality performance, corrective actions, and acceptance history
- Support the development and standardization of inspection procedures, checklists, templates, and metrology best practices
- Communicate inspection results and recommendations clearly to internal stakeholders and external suppliers
- Participate in vendor quality initiatives, root cause investigations, and continuous improvement activities
- Identify recurring tooling quality trends and recommend improvements to specifications, inspection processes, and supplier performance
